In 1.4-dev5 when we started to implement keep-alive, commit a9679ac
("[MINOR] http: make the conditional redirect support keep-alive")
added a specific check was added to support keep-alive on redirect
rules but only when the location would start with a "/" indicating
the client would come back to the same server.
But nowadays most applications put http:// or https:// in front of
each and every location, and continuing to perform a close there is
counter-efficient, especially when multiple objects are fetched at
once from a same origin which redirects them to the correct origin
(eg: after an http to https forced upgrade).
It's about time to get rid of this old trick as it causes more harm
than good at an era where persistent connections are omnipresent.
Special thanks to Ciprian Dorin Craciun for providing convincing
arguments with a pretty valid use case and proposing this draft
patch which addresses the issue he was facing.
This change although not exactly a bug fix should be backported
to 1.7 to adapt better to existing infrastructure.
Adrian Fitzpatrick reported that since commit f51658d ("MEDIUM: config:
relax use_backend check to make the condition optional"), typos like "of"
instead of "if" on use_backend rules are not properly detected. The reason
is that the parser only checks for "if" or "unless" otherwise it considers
there's no keyword, making the rule inconditional.
This patch fixes it. It may reveal some rare config bugs for some people,
but will not affect valid configurations.
This fix must be backported to 1.7, 1.6 and 1.5.

Commit 405ff31 ("BUG/MINOR: ssl: assert on SSL_set_shutdown with BoringSSL")
introduced a regression causing some random crashes apparently due to
memory corruption. The issue is the use of SSL_CTX_set_quiet_shutdown()
instead of SSL_set_quiet_shutdown(), making it use a different structure
and causing the flag to be put who-knows-where.
Many thanks to Jarno Huuskonen who reported this bug early and who
bisected the issue to spot this patch. No backport is needed, this
is 1.8-specific.

Some users have experienced some troubles using the compression filter when the
HTTP response body length is undefined. They complained about receiving
truncated responses.
In fact, the bug can be triggered if there is at least one filter attached to
the stream but none registered to analyze the HTTP response body. In this case,
when the body length is undefined, data should be forwarded without any
parsing. But, because of a wrong check, we were starting to parse them. Because
it was not expected, the end of response was not correctly detected and the
response could be truncted. So now, we rely on HAS_DATA_FILTER macro instead of
HAS_FILTER one to choose to parse HTTP response body or not.
Furthermore, in http_response_forward_body, the test to not forward the server
closure to the client has been updated to reflect conditions listed in the
associated comment.
And finally, in http_msg_forward_body, when the body length is undefined, we
continue the parsing it until the server closes the connection without any on
filters. So filters can safely stop to filter data during their parsing.
This fix should be backported in 1.7

If we use the action "http-request redirect" with a Lua sample-fetch or
converter, and the Lua function calls one of the Lua log function, the
header name is corrupted, it contains an extract of the last loggued data.
This is due to an overwrite of the trash buffer, because his scope is not
respected in the "add-header" function. The scope of the trash buffer must
be limited to the function using it. The build_logline() function can
execute a lot of other function which can use the trash buffer.
This patch fix the usage of the trash buffer. It limits the scope of this
global buffer to the local function, we build first the header value using
build_logline, and after we store the header name.
Thanks Jesse Schulman for the bug repport.
This patch must be backported in 1.7, 1.6 and 1.5 version, and it relies
on commit b686afd ("MINOR: chunks: implement a simple dynamic allocator for
trash buffers") for the trash allocator, which has to be backported as well.
The trash buffers are becoming increasingly complex to deal with due to
the code's modularity allowing some functions to be chained and causing
the same chunk buffers to be used multiple times along the chain, possibly
corrupting each other. In fact the trash were designed from scratch for
explicitly not surviving a function call but string manipulation makes
this impossible most of the time while not fullfilling the need for
reliable temporary chunks.
Here we introduce the ability to allocate a temporary trash chunk which
is reserved, so that it will not conflict with the trash chunks other
functions use, and will even support reentrant calls (eg: build_logline).
For this, we create a new pool which is exactly the size of a usual chunk
buffer plus the size of the chunk struct so that these chunks when allocated
are exactly the same size as the ones returned by get_trash_buffer(). These
chunks may fail so the caller must check them, and the caller is also
responsible for freeing them.
The code focuses on minimal changes and ease of reliable backporting
because it will be needed in stable versions in order to support next
patch.
UDP sockets used to send DNS queries are created before fork happens and
this is a big problem because all the processes (in case of a
configuration starting multiple processes) share the same socket. Some
processes may consume responses dedicated to an other one, some servers
may be disabled, some IPs changed, etc...
As a workaround, this patch close the existing socket and create a new
one after the fork() has happened.
[wt: backport this to 1.7]

There's a test after a successful synchronous connect() consisting
in waking the data layer up asap if there's no more handshake.
Unfortunately this test is run before setting the CO_FL_SEND_PROXY
flag and before the transport layer adds its own flags, so it can
indicate a willingness to send data while it's not the case and it
will have to be handled later.
This has no visible effect except a useless call to a function in
case of health checks making use of the proxy protocol for example.
Additionally a corner case where EALREADY was returned and considered
equivalent to EISCONN was fixed so that it's considered equivalent to
EINPROGRESS given that the connection is not complete yet. But this
code should never return on the first call anyway so it's mostly a
cleanup.
This fix should be backported to 1.7 and 1.6 at least to avoid
headaches during some debugging.
While testing a tcp_fastopen related change, it appeared that in the rare
case where connect() can immediately succeed, we still subscribe to write
notifications on the socket, causing the conn_fd_handler() to immediately
be called and a second call to connect() to be attempted to double-check
the connection.
In fact this issue had already been met with unix sockets (which often
respond immediately) and partially addressed but incorrect so another
patch will follow. But for TCP nothing was done.
The fix consists in removing the WAIT_L4_CONN flag if connect() succeeds
and to subscribe for writes only if some handshakes or L4_CONN are still
needed. In addition in order not to fail raw TCP health checks, we have
to continue to enable polling for data when nothing is scheduled for
leaving and the connection is already established, otherwise the caller
will never be notified.
This fix should be backported to 1.7 and 1.6.

This function was deprecated in 1.1.0 causing this warning :
src/ssl_sock.c:551:3: warning: 'RAND_pseudo_bytes' is deprecated (declared at /opt/openssl-1.1.0/include/openssl/rand.h:47) [-Wdeprecated-declarations]
The man suggests to use RAND_bytes() instead. While the return codes
differ, it turns out that the function was already misused and was
relying on RAND_bytes() return code instead.
The patch was tested on 0.9.8, 1.0.0, 1.0.1, 1.0.2 and 1.1.0.
This fix must be backported to 1.7 and the return code check should
be backported to earlier versions if relevant.

The previous version used an O(number of proxies)^2 algo to get the sum of
the number of maxconns of frontends which reference a backend at least once.
This new version adds the frontend's maxconn number to the backend's
struct proxy member 'tot_fe_maxconn' when the backend name is resolved
for switching rules or default_backend statment. At the end, the final
backend's fullconn is computed looping only one time for all on proxies O(n).
The load of a configuration using a large amount of backends (10 thousands)
without configured fullconn was reduced from several minutes to few seconds.

The DNS code is written so as to support AF_UNSPEC to decide on the
server family based on responses, but unfortunately snr_resolution_cb()
considers it as invalid causing a DNS storm to happen when a server
arrives with this family.
This situation is not supposed to happen as long as unresolved addresses
are forced to AF_INET, but this will change with the upcoming fixes and
it's possible that it's not granted already when changing an address on
the CLI.
This fix must be backported to 1.7 and 1.6.

http-reuse should normally not be used in conjunction with the proxy
protocol or with "usesrc clientip". While there's nothing fundamentally
wrong with this, whenever these options are used, the server expects the
IP address to be the source address for all requests, which doesn't make
sense with http-reuse.

Commits 5f10ea3 ("OPTIM: http: improve parsing performance of long
URIs") and 0431f9d ("OPTIM: http: improve parsing performance of long
header lines") introduced a bug in the HTTP parser : when a partial
request is read, the first part ends up on a 8-bytes boundary (or 4-byte
on 32-bit machines), the end lies in the header field value part, and
the buffer used to contain a CR character exactly after the last block,
then the parser could be confused and read this CR character as being
part of the current request, then switch to a new state waiting for an
LF character. Then when the next part of the request appeared, it would
read the character following what was erroneously mistaken for a CR,
see that it is not an LF and fail on a bad request. In some cases, it
can even be worse and the header following the hole can be improperly
indexed causing all sort of unexpected behaviours like a content-length
being ignored or a header appended at the wrong position. The reason is
that there's no control of and of parsing just after breaking out of the
loop.
